Item 1.01. Entry into a New Definitive Agreement

On September 17, 2021, Priority Holdings, LLC, as borrower (the "Borrower"), the guarantors party thereto, certain lenders party thereto, and Truist Bank, as administrative agent and collateral agent, entered into the Second Amendment to Credit and Guaranty Agreement (the "Amendment"), which amended the Credit and Guaranty Agreement dated as of April 27, 2021 (the "Credit Agreement"), among the Borrower, the credit parties party thereto from time to time, the lenders party thereto from time to time, and Truist Bank, as administrative agent, collateral agent, issuing bank and swingline lender. The Amendment provides for commitments from certain lenders to increase the amount of the delayed draw term loan facility under the Credit Agreement by $30,000,000, which additional loans were funded together with the original commitments for delayed draw term loans under the Credit Agreement concurrently with, and to provide financing for, the closing of the Acquisition (as defined in Item 2.01 below). The additional delayed draw term loans are part of the same class of term loans under the Credit Agreement, and are subject to the same terms and secured and guarantied on the same basis, as the delayed draw term loans made pursuant the original commitments under the Credit Agreement.

Item 2.01.
Completion of Acquisition or Disposition of Assets
On September 17, 2021, Priority Technology Holdings, Inc. (the “Company”), through its indirect, wholly-owned subsidiary, Prime Warrior Acquisition Corp. ( “Merger Sub”), completed its acquisition of Finxera Holdings, Inc. (“Finxera”) pursuant to the Agreement and Plan of Merger dated as of March 5, 2021, as amended (the “Merger Agreement”) by and among the Company, Merger Sub, Finxera and Stone Point Capital, solely in its capacity as the Equityholder Representative thereunder. As of September 17, 2021, in accordance with the Merger Agreement, Finxera became a wholly owned subsidiary of the Company (the “Acquisition”).

As a result of the Acquisition, the Company acquired all of the outstanding equity interests of Finxera for a total consideration consisting of (a) approximately $375 million in cash (the “Cash Consideration”) and (b) an aggregate of approximately 7.6 million shares (the “Stock Consideration”) of common stock, par value $0.001, of the Company (“Common Stock”). The Cash Consideration was funded via, among other sources, (1) drawings of $320 under the Company’s Credit and Guaranty Agreement (the “Credit Agreement”) with Truist Bank and (2) an issuance pursuant to the Company’s Securities Purchase Agreement with certain affiliates of Ares Management Corporation of an additional 75,000 shares of the Company’s Senior Preferred Stock, par value $0.001 (“Preferred Stock”), at a purchase price of $75.0 million or $1,000 per share.

The Stock Consideration and the Preferred Stock were issued in a private placement pursuant to an exemption from registration under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), provided by Section 4(a)(2) of the Securities Act and Rule 506(b) promulgated under the Securities Act.

Completes Acquisition of Finxera to Create the Premier Payments and Banking as a Service Platform Combined Pro Forma 2021 Revenue of $547 to $570 Million and Combined Pro Forma Adjusted EBITDA of $131 to $136 Million Before Synergies ALPHARETTA, Ga., Sept. 17, 2021 /PRNewswire/ -- Priority Technology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: PRTH) ("Priority"), a leading payments technology company helping customers collect, store and send money, today announced that it has completed the acquisition of Finxera Holdings, Inc. ("Finxera"), a pioneer in the fintech industry that launched and operated one of the first Banking as a Service ("BaaS") platforms. About Priority Technology Holdings, Inc. Priority is a leading provider of merchant acquiring, integrated payment software and corporate payment solutions, offering unique product and service capabilities to its merchant network and distribution partners. Priority's enterprise operates from a purpose-built payments infrastructure that includes tailored customer service offerings and bespoke technology development, allowing Priority to provide end-to-end solutions for payment and payment-adjacent software. Additional information can be found at www.PRTH.com. About Finxera Holdings, Inc. Finxera operates the leading BaaS platform that allows enterprises to rapidly incorporate banking and payment services into their applications. Its API driven approach has enabled the integration into one platform all aspects of banking and payments, including account opening, reconciliation, sub account ledgering, ACH, checks, wires, and card issuance. Using the Finxera BaaS, enterprises are able to collect, store and send money in a simple, secure and compliant manner, including those involving complex financial regulatory frameworks.
